Transaction

101fa77c7b6dfa25f8e5ae88d80e8dbb9aa97077fc20e6fb97614da1718a22c4
368,116 confirmations
Timestamp
1554161111
Block569,793
Fee12,000 sats
Fee rate60 sats/vB
view on mempool.space

Inputs & Outputs